Inviron wins Burnley Hospital PFI contract

Inviron
Inviron continues its involvement with Bovis Lend Lease with the M&E contract for the a PFI scheme at Burnley General Hospital.
The £6.5 million contract for M&E services for the PFI scheme at Burnley General Hospital has been won by the Manchester office of Inviron. The Phase V project for East Lancashire Healthcare NHS Trust includes 170 medical beds, 15-bed renal day unit, outpatients’ unit with support accommodation, and dedicated rehabilitation outpatients, integrated with specialist inpatient accommodation. Bovis Lend Lease awarded the contract.

BCIA welcomes tougher commercial building energy standards but calls for greater ambition across the wider sector

The Building Controls Industry Association (BCIA) has welcomed the government’s confirmation that privately rented non-domestic buildings over 1,000 square metres in England and Wales will be expected to achieve a minimum EPC B rating by 2031, describing the move as an important step forward in improving the energy performance of the UK’s commercial building stock.
